G. Bottura is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Organic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, G. Bottura has authored 32 papers receiving a total of 457 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 6 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 5 papers in Organic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in G. Bottura's work include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(5 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(5 papers) and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(4 papers). G. Bottura is often cited by papers focused on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(5 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(5 papers) and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(4 papers). G. Bottura coll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United Kingdom and Canada. G. Bottura's co-authors include Paola Taddei, G. Fini, Vitaliano Tugnoli, M. R. Tosi, Anna Tinti, Giancarlo Ranalli, Marco Marchetti, C. Sorlini, G.C. Barker and Andrea Trinchero and has published in prestigious journ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Biopolymers and Lung Cancer.
